Sanofi is recruiting a new Global Leader in Medical Affairs to support product development through medical strategy and guidance for Dupilumab in the Global Immunology Franchise for Gastroenterology. Dupilumab has the potential to be a game changer in Eosinophilic Esophagitis (EoE) and to be part of a paradigm shift. The new Leader will report directly into Head, Global Medical Affairs, Rhinology and Gastroenterology.
With guidance from the Head, Global Medical Affairs Rhinology and Gastroenterology the new leader will be an integral part of building the global medical affairs strategy in line with the brand strategy built in partnership with our cross functional colleagues and Regeneron. The exceptional new hire will have strong content area expertise in Gastroenterology and/or a desire to work in the immune-inflammation space with a solid working knowledge and background in Medical Affairs.
Main responsibilities:
Support the Head of Global Medical Affairs Dupilumab Rhinology and Gastroenterology and collaborate with the other members of the team in the build and execution of Global Med Affairs strategy for EoE.
Build and execute the Life Cycle management for Dupilumab in EoE; define and prioritize the future needs including new study ideas and tactics to prioritize the best areas for clinical trial investment.
Collaborate with alliance partners at Regeneron: take a team-oriented approach to making sure strategy is clearly defined and consistent with relevant stakeholders in clinical development and commercial teams.
Collaborate with R&D and support clinical development programs for alliance assets in Gastroenterology at different stages of development.
Coordinate data gap analyses across the Regions and countries.
Contribute to the development and execution of the Integrated Evidence Generation Plan (IEGP).
Collaborate with the Alliance to execute the data generation activities in alignment with the Brand plan and Global Medical Affairs Plan.
Guide physician/scientist in charge of the execution of the Life Cycle Management (LCM) and data generation.
Establish and maintain strong relationships with experts in the Gastroenterology field, academics and professionals medical/scientific organizations and patient associations.
Prior knowledge of and established relationships with key opinion leaders in Gastroenterology considered an asset.
Lead advisory boards or roundtables and gain strategic insights for medical, scientific, and development strategy.
Give significant input to publications and co-author relevant abstracts. Drive process of data dissemination and ensure that it is publicly presented in an appropriate and timely fashion and in a fair and balanced manner.
Ensure the scientific integrity of sponsored and supported research, information, and relationships with healthcare providers and patient advocacy groups.
Ensure a data-driven, patient-centric approach to development of medical strategy both for product and device development as well as possible services which can enhance the value proposition of the product.
Provide relevant feedback to market access teams to ensure optimal pricing and reimbursement strategy and inclusion of relevant endpoints in clinical trials.
Travel required, comprising approximately 20-30% of time.
